On 11/12/12 12:56, Will Wagner wrote:
> I ported newer X11 to buildroot a while back a posted a link to the repository. At the time the only comment I got was
> from Thomas about the requirement for python/libxml2 which he hated then as well :)
>
> I patched it so that it conditionally build host-libxml2 with the reuqired support if mesa3d was selected. My patch for
> this is at https://gitorious.org/willw-buildroot/willw-buildroot/commit/421b4fd572869b22de11a0f0fad161e284c41bcc
>
> If we want newer mesa3d support I think we are going to have to come up with some suitable solution for this.

  Yes, and your patch looks in pretty good shape already.  I would make
BR2_PACKAGE_HOST_LIBXML2_PYTHON a blind option (i.e. remove the string after
bool).  I'd also remove the dependency on BR2_PACKAGE_LIBXML2 (in fact,
mesa3d doesn't require libxml2).  And I'd keep the --without-debug.  But
otherwise the patch looks good :-)

  Care to post it to the list, followed by a mesa3d patch that uses it?
